چكيده فارسي :
اﺳﺘﺨﻮان ﯾﻮروﻫﯿﺎل ﺳﺎﺧﺘﺎري ﺳﺨﺖ در ﺳﺮ ﻣﺎﻫﯽ ﻣﯽ ﺑﺎﺷﺪ ﮐﻪ ﻧﻘﺶ ﺑﺴﺰاﯾﯽ در ﻣﮑﺎﻧﯿﺴﻢ ﺑﺎز و ﺑﺴﺘﻪ ﺷﺪن دﻫﺎن و در ﻧﺘﯿﺠﻪ ﺗﻐﺬﯾﻪ ﻣﺎﻫﯽ دارد. ﺑﻨﺎﺑﺮاﯾﻦ، ﯾﮑﯽ از ﻓﺮ ﺿﯿﺎت ﻣﻬﻢ در راﺑﻄﻪ ﺑﺎ ﺗﻨﻮع ﺷﮑﻠﯽ ا ﺳﺘﺨﻮان ﯾﻮروﻫﯿﺎل اﯾﻦ ا ﺳﺖ ﮐﻪ ﺷﮑﻞ آن ﻋﻼوه ﺑﺮ اﻟﮕﻮي ﺗﻐﺬﯾﻪ ﻣﺎﻫﯽ، ﻣﺘﺎﺛﺮ از رﯾﺨﺖﺷﻨﺎﺳﯽ ﺧﺎرﺟﯽ ﺑﺪن ﻣﺎﻫﯿﺎن و ﺑﻮﯾﮋه اﺑﻌﺎد ﺳﺮ ﻣﺎﻫﯿﺎن اﺳﺖ. از اﯾﻨﺮو، ﺷﻨﺎﺧﺖ و ﻣﻄﺎﻟﻌﻪ وﯾﮋﮔﯽﻫﺎي ﮐﻤﯽ و ﮐﯿﻔﯽ ﯾﻮروﻫﯿﺎل ﻣﯽﺗﻮاﻧﺪ ﯾﮏ ﻣﻌﯿﺎر ﻣﻨﺎﺳﺐ ﺟﻬﺖ ﺷﻨﺎﺳﺎﯾﯽ ﻣﺎﻫﯿﺎن، ﻣﻄﺎﻟﻌﺎت اﮐﻮﻟﻮژﯾﮑﯽ و ﻧﯿﺰ ﻣﻄﺎﻟﻌﺎت ﻣﺮﺗﺒﻂ ﺑﺎ رﻓﺘﺎرﻫﺎي ﺗﻐﺬﯾﻪ اي ﻣﺎﻫﯿﺎن ﺑﺎﺷـﺪ. در اﯾﻦ ﻣﻄﺎﻟﻌﻪ، ﺗﻨﻮع ﺷـﮑﻠﯽ ﻫﺸـﺖ ﮔﻮﻧﻪ ﻣﺎﻫﯽ درﯾﺎﯾﯽ ﺑﺎ ﺗﻨﻮع رﯾﺨﺘﯽ اﺳـﺘﺨﻮان ﯾﻮرﻫﯿﺎل آﻧﻬﺎ ﻣﻘﺎﯾﺴـﻪ ﺷـﺪه اﺳـﺖ ﺗﺎ ﺷﻨﺎﺧﺖ ﺑﯿ ﺸﺘﺮي از اﻟﮕﻮي ﺗﻐﯿﯿﺮات اﯾﻦ ا ﺳﺘﺨﻮان در ﻣﺎﻫﯿﺎن ﺑﺪ ﺳﺖ آﯾﺪ. ﺑﺮ ا ﺳﺎس اﯾﻦ ﻣﻄﺎﻟﻌﻪ، ﺳﻄﺢ ﺷﮑﻤﯽ ﯾﻮروﻫﯿﺎل ﻣﺘﻨﺎ ﺳﺐ ﺑﺎ ﺳﻄﺢ ﺷﮑﻤﯽ ﺳﺮ و ﺳﻄﺢ ﺟﺎﻧﺒﯽ ﯾﻮروﻫﯿﺎل ﻣﺘﻨﺎﺳﺐ ﺑﺎ ارﺗﻔﺎع ﺳﺮ در ﻣﺎﻫﯿﺎن اﺳﺖ. ﺑﻨﻈﺮ ﻣﯽرﺳﺪ ﮐﻪ اﯾﻦ اﻟﮕﻮي ﺗﻐﯿﯿﺮات در ﺑﺪن ﻣﺎﻫﯽ، اﺑﻌﺎد ﺳﺮ ﻣﺎﻫﯽ و ﺷﮑﻞ ا ﺳﺘﺨﻮان ﯾﻮروﻫﯿﺎل ﺑﻬﺘﺮﯾﻦ و ﮐﺎراﻣﺪﺗﺮﯾﻦ ﺳﺎزﮔﺎري در راﺑﻄﻪ ﺑﺎ ﺗﻐﺬﯾﻪ ﻣﺎﻫﯿﺎن از زﯾﺴﺘﮕﺎﻫﻬﺎي ﻣﻨﺤﺼﺮ ﺑﻪ ﻓﺮد خودﺷﺎن ﻣﯽ ﺑﺎﺷﺪ.
چكيده لاتين :
Urohyal bone is a hard structure in the head of fishes that plays a significant role in the opening and closing of the mouth and consequently the feeding of fish. Therefore, one of the most important issues with regard to the shape variety in urohyal bone is that in addition to the pattern of fish nutrition, the overall shape of this bone is influenced by external morphology of fish body, and especially dimension of the fish head. Therefore, recognizing and studying the qualitative and quantitative characteristics of this bony structure can be a suitable criterion for identifying fish, ecological studies, and also studies related to the nutritional behavior of fishes. In this research, morphological variation of eight marine fish species has been compared with variety seen in their urohyal bone for a better understanding of the pattern of variation in structure in fishes. According to this study, the shape of ventral surface of urohyal bone is appropriate to the ventral surface of the head, and the lateral surface of the urohyal corresponding to the height of the fish head. It seems that this pattern of changes in fish body, size of the head and the shape of urohyal bone is the best and most effective adaptation to the feeding of fish in their unique habitats.
